What is a High Cube Shipping Container?
High cube shipping containers are similar to standard shipping containers however are 1 foot taller. Generally, this added height makes them an exceptional option for carrying large products or taking full advantage of storage area. While basic shipping containers usually determine 8 feet high, high cube containers measure 9.5 feet tall.
Specifications of High Cube Containers
To better understand the dimensions and capabilities of high cube Shipping Container Housing containers, let's take a look at a comparison table.
| Container Type | Length (feet) | Width (ft) | Height (ft) | Interior Volume (cubic feet) | Payload Capacity (pounds)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Standard 20' Container | 20 | 8 | 8.5 | 1,169 | 52,910 |
| High Cube 20' Container | 20 | 8 | 9.5 | 1,308 | 52,910 |
| Standard 40' Container | 40 | 8 | 8.5 | 2,387 | 61,000 |
| High Cube 40' Container | 40 | 8 | 9.5 | 2,694 | 61,000 |
Table 1: Specifications of Standard vs. High Cube Shipping Containers
Key Features of High Cube Shipping Containers
- Increased Height: As discussed earlier, the additional height provides additional space for taller items or more volume overall.
- Toughness: Made of durable steel, these containers are developed to stand up to severe environmental conditions.
- Adaptability: High cube containers can be used for storage, shipping, and even transformed into living or commercial areas.
- Security: They provide robust security functions to keep contents safe from theft and damage.
- Portability: Like standard containers, high cubes can be quickly carried by means of truck, rail, or ship.
Applications of High Cube Shipping Containers
High cube containers are utilized across numerous markets for various purposes, including:
- Shipping and Logistics: Perfect for carrying extra-large and lightweight items, such as mattresses, devices, and fabrics.
- Storage Solutions: Frequently used for short-term or permanent storage due to their large interiors.
- Modular Housing: Increasingly popular for constructing little homes, workplaces, and even pop-up shops.
- Mobile Offices: Converted into on-site offices for construction tasks or remote workstations.

High Cube Container FAQs
1. What are the primary distinctions in between standard and high cube shipping containers?
The main distinction in between standard and high cube containers is height. High cube containers are an additional foot taller than standard containers, offering more interior volume.
2. Can high cube containers be stacked?
Yes, high cube containers can be stacked similar to basic containers. They are created for stacking during shipping and storage, which maximizes area utilization.
3. What types of items are appropriate for high cube containers?
High cube containers are ideal for carrying bulky products, such as furniture, machinery, or large quantities of light-weight items like fabrics. They are likewise ideal for items that need vertical storage.
4. Are high cube containers weather-resistant?
Yes, high cube containers are made from heavy-duty steel with protective finishings to stand up to severe weather condition conditions. However, appropriate ventilation is important to prevent moisture accumulation inside when Used Cargo Containers for long-term storage.
